Abstract
Fibonacci (alias Chebyshev) polynomials enjoy particular composition properties. These can be seen (and proved) from a combinatorial perspective by interpreting these polynomials as matching polynomials. An enumerative technique for cyclic structures is applied to obtain a generating polynomial identity for cyclic products of binomial coefficients in terms of matching polynomials.
